Crystal Palace 2-3 Burnley: Clarets Complete Stunning First-Half Comeback
A sensational first-half turnaround saw Burnley recover from 2-0 down to defeat Crystal Palace 3-2 at Selhurst Park in one of the Premier League’s most dramatic games of the season. Crystal Palace’s £43 million signing Jørgen Strand-Larsen struck twice inside 32 minutes to give the hosts what looked like a commanding lead. Crystal Palace vs Burnley Preview: Can Oliver Glasner’s Side Pull Clear of Relegation Trouble?
Crystal Palace return to Selhurst Park looking to build on their morale-boosting win over Brighton as they aim to create breathing room in the Premier League relegation battle. After a turbulent month both on and off the pitch, Palace sit 13th in the table with 32 points from 25 matches.
